**Dependency pinning at Quornfield**

All services pin exact versions. No ranges, no wildcards. Lockfiles are committed and reviewed like code. Upgrades go through the Brindlecap bot, one dependency per PR, with changelog links. Security bumps skip the queue but still need a green build. Releases with unpinned transitive deps get blocked automatically. The full policy and exemption process live at the page below.

operations page: https://jenkins.zemvarcloud.local/job/merge_requests/repo/build/73930b4b30f0a8ed

# Service Accounts — Brambledocs RBAC

Quick rundown for your review: Brambledocs uses three roles — reader, scribe, and warden — mapped through the Gatehouse auth proxy. Service accounts only ever get reader or scribe; warden is human-only, enforced at the proxy. The wiki-sync bot (scribe) mirrors pages into the archive nightly and can't touch permissions. It authenticates to the Gatehouse API with the key below.

gateway credential: kto3_qfe

Subject: Occupancy feed access — Garrowby Deck

Team,

The Lotbeam occupancy feed for the Garrowby Deck garage is now live on our staging gateway. Polling interval is 30s; payloads are signed and carry no plate data. Rate limit is 60 req/min per client. For your review, requests should be authenticated with the bearer token below.

login token, hawef-kahof: eyJhbGciOiJIUzI1NiIsInR5cCI6IkpXVCJ9.eyJzdWIiOiIxQ8nm1In0.OfwP90Sx

Action item: The Relayn deploy-status bot silently dropped updates when the pipeline API paginated results, so responders believed a rollback had completed when it had not. We will add pagination handling, a staleness banner, and an integration test. Until merged, verify deploy state directly in the pipeline console, documented at the page below.

runbook for kahop-kajop: https://rundeck.ordinio.test/display/secrets/pipeline/issue/pages/repo/browse/e5732776e07d1285107e5aeb